Nova Southeastern vs. Galen Health Institutes-Gainesville
Both Nova Southeastern University and Galen Health Institutes-Gainesville are 4 years schools located in Florida. The following statements compare Nova Southeastern University and Galen Health Institutes-Gainesville with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- Nova Southeastern's tuition ($37,080) is more expensive than Galen Health Institutes-Gainesville ($16,400).

-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,180.
- Galen Health Institutes-Gainesville's students to faculty ratio (12 to 1) is lower than Nova Southeastern (17 to 1).
- Nova Southeastern (20,877 students) is larger than Galen Health Institutes-Gainesville (638 students) with more enrolled students.
- Nova Southeastern ($21,686) has higher amount of financial aid than Galen Health Institutes-Gainesville ($4,920).
- Both schools have same graduation rate of 64%.
